Job Description:

Alvarez & Marsal (A&M) is a premier independent global professional services firm specializing in providing turnaround management, restructuring, performance improvement and corporate advisory services.

The Healthcare Industry Group (HIG), a subsidiary of A&M, is an established leader known for delivering tangible results for healthcare c-suite executives, boards, private equity firms, investors, law firms and government agencies that are facing complex challenges. We are at the forefront of delivering transformational change to the healthcare industry. Our professionals advise our clients on financial, operational and market performance by assessing all aspects of their operations and providing comprehensive services, including analyzing revenue and financial information, conducting process reviews, identifying key business drivers, and managing risk and compliance issues. HIG also provides services such as revenue cycle management, mergers and acquisitions, compliance and regulatory, information technology and interim management.

You will have the opportunity to work with clients in a variety of sectors including health systems and providers, physician groups, ancillary providers, medical schools, vision, laboratory, dental and behavior health; managed care and health plans, government plans and programs, healthcare investors and lenders, medical devices, healthcare suppliers and infrastructure, life sciences, pharma, and biotech.

What will you be doing?

As a Senior Associate you will be working closely with healthcare clients on a range of complex assignments. You will work in a team environment while using your independent judgement and critical thinking skills to gather data, frame situations and provide practical solutions to add value based on client needs. Depending on the client project the responsibilities of a Senior Associate may typically include:


  • Building and managing financial models, conducting financial and operating analyses, and drafting pro-forma financial statements

  • Conducting client interviews to gain an understanding of and evaluate aspects of client situation and operations

  • Developing operational data analysis to develop KPI metrics

  • Effectively summarizing, drawing conclusions and creating recommendations from large data sets or analyses

  • Leading various work streams within a project, including managing day to day engagement priorities with guidance from senior leaders

  • Preparing client-ready deliverables and presentations; making presentations to clients

  • Coaching and mentoring junior staff both formally and informally

  • Building relationships with clients and seeking opportunities to expand the scope of business

  • Supporting marketing initiatives by assisting with the pitch preparation process and creation of marketing materials

  • Helping to build product and service offering tools and templates

What are we looking for?


  • High energy individuals with a passion for healthcare and solving complex issues

  • A minimum of five (5) years of prior work experience in healthcare, consulting or healthcare industry such as healthcare banking, accounting, audit, private equity, managed care, health plans or healthcare operations with a healthcare focus

  • BA/BS degree and/or MBA/MS in Accounting, Finance, or other related healthcare fields such as MHA or MPH

  • Professional certifications such as Certified Public Accountant (CPA), Chartered Financial Analyst (CFA), or demonstrated progress toward such certifications a plus

  • Advanced level of Excel proficiency and experience in financial modeling with the ability to build 13-week cash flow forecast and three statement model from scratch

  • Advanced Microsoft PowerPoint and Word skills a must; experience with Tableau, SQL, SPSS, Power BI, Action O-I benchmarking, MGMA survey data a plus

  • Solid project management and organizational skills

  • Working knowledge of healthcare industry, including a fundamental understanding of healthcare finance, operations, valuation and various laws and regulations

  • Ability to use sound judgment and escalate project issues to project managers or engagement leaders

  • Ability to coach and mentor junior staff

  • Excellent verbal and written skills, with the ability to communicate with and present information to all levels of client personnel

  • Willingness and ability to travel as required
